Quantum Scholars is currently seeking experienced Primary SEND tutors to provide 1:1 tuition in home and off-site settings for pupils accessing alternative provision across Wokingham and the surrounding areas of Berkshire. This role focuses on supporting primary-aged pupils who are not currently in mainstream education. Many of the children we work with have additional needs, including SEND, Autism, ADHD, SEMH, behavioural challenges, or medical conditions. This is a rewarding opportunity to work closely with individual learners, delivering personalised sessions that build confidence, develop core skills, and support their journey back into education.

Tuition typically takes place in the pupil's home or in a suitable community setting, with tutors responsible for planning and adapting lessons to meet each child's needs.

How to prepare for a job interview at Academics

✨Know Your SEND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of Special Educational Needs and Disabilities (SEND). Familiarise yourself with the specific needs of children with Autism, ADHD, and SEMH. This will show that you're not just qualified but genuinely passionate about supporting these learners.

✨Showcase Your Behaviour Management Skills

Prepare to discuss your strategies for managing behaviour in a one-on-one setting. Think of examples from your past experiences where you've successfully built positive relationships with pupils. This is crucial for the role, so be ready to impress!

✨Flexibility is Key

Since the role offers flexible, part-time opportunities, be clear about your availability during school hours. Highlight your willingness to adapt to different settings, whether it's at home or in the community, to meet the needs of your students.

✨Plan a Sample Lesson

Consider preparing a brief outline of a sample lesson tailored for a primary-aged pupil with SEND. This could be a great way to demonstrate your ability to plan and adapt lessons. It shows initiative and gives the interviewers a glimpse of your teaching style.
